实力

Chinese HSK 3 Vocabulary Chinese ★★★ 3/5 slightly formal shí lì
Pinyin shí lì
Hanzi breakdown 实 = 宀 (roof) + component, simplified from 實, meaning solid or real; 力 = pictograph of a muscular arm, meaning strength or power

Meaning

Strength; actual power; capability. The real ability or power that someone or something possesses.

Refers to genuine, demonstrated capability rather than potential or appearance. Used for individuals (他很有实力 = he is very capable), teams, companies, and nations. Common collocations: 经济实力 (economic strength), 军事实力 (military power), 综合实力 (overall strength). Implies substance and proven ability rather than mere reputation.

Examples

  1. 这支球队的实力非常强。 This team's strength is very formidable.
  2. 一个国家的发展离不开经济实力。 A country's development cannot do without economic strength.
  3. 比赛要靠真正的实力,不能靠运气。 Competition relies on real ability, not luck.

Usage Guide

Context: competition, business, sports, politics

Tone: assertive

Do Say

  • 他是一个很有实力的选手。(He is a very capable competitor.)
  • 公司的实力越来越强了。(The company's strength is growing stronger and stronger.)

Don't Say

  • 我今天没有实力去跑步。(Don't use 实力 for daily energy levels — use 力气 or 精力. 实力 is for overall capability, not momentary physical energy.)

Origin & History

实 means solid, real, or actual; 力 means power or strength. Together: real, substantive power — genuine capability.
